What Is a Polyester Body?
A polyester body is a vehicle mounted body system installed on a commercial vehicle chassis and manufactured using polyester, composite or fiber reinforced panels depending on the project requirements. It can be designed as an enclosed body, semi enclosed body, dry cargo body, service body, shelf equipped body or custom project body according to the intended use. Its main purpose is to transport commercial goods, dry cargo, equipment, packaged materials and service vehicle parts in a clean, protected, organized and lightweight body structure.
A polyester body should not be considered only as a lightweight outer shell. In professional production, vehicle chassis dimensions, load capacity, daily usage intensity, cargo type, body length, interior height, floor structure, door system, seals, locks, interior surface protection, cargo securing points and exterior appearance expectations must be evaluated together. If these details are not planned correctly, the expected efficiency from a polyester body cannot be achieved. For this reason, a polyester body is a technical commercial vehicle body solution that should be designed according to the real transport needs of the business.

Difference Between Polyester Body and Closed Sheet Metal Body
Polyester body and closed sheet metal body systems can be used in similar commercial transport operations, but they differ in material structure, weight, surface character and usage style. A closed sheet metal body can offer a more metallic, stronger and impact resistant structure. A polyester body can be lighter, cleaner surfaced and more aesthetic in some projects. The correct choice should be determined according to the cargo type, usage intensity, vehicle capacity and expectations of the business.
| Comparison Criteria | Polyester Body | Closed Sheet Metal Body |
|---|---|---|
| Material Structure | Polyester, composite or fiber reinforced panel structure | Sheet metal and steel supported metal body structure |
| Weight | Can be lighter depending on the project | Can generally offer a heavier structure |
| Surface Appearance | Provides a smooth, clean and modern surface | Offers a metallic, strong and classic body appearance |
| Impact Resistance | Depends on material quality and project design | Can be advantageous in intensive and rough use |
| Maintenance Need | Surface cracks, impact marks and connections should be checked | Paint, rust and metal deformation should be monitored |
| Usage Area | Suitable for light and medium commercial shipments | Can be preferred for more intensive and demanding transport work |
Difference Between Polyester Body and Aluminum Body
Polyester body and aluminum body systems are two different alternatives for businesses that want lightness and clean appearance. Aluminum body stands out with its profile, panel and metal connection structure. Polyester body attracts attention with its composite like surface and smooth exterior appearance. When deciding between these two options, cargo type, exterior appearance expectations, usage intensity, maintenance convenience and budget should be evaluated together.
| Comparison Criteria | Polyester Body | Aluminum Body |
|---|---|---|
| Structure Character | Polyester or composite surfaced structure | Aluminum profile, panel or sheet structure |
| Weight | Can be lightweight depending on the project | Usually offers a lightweight structure |
| Exterior Appearance | Provides a smooth and clean appearance | Offers a metallic, modern and corporate appearance |
| Repair | May require special repair depending on surface damage | Part based maintenance and replacement can be possible |
| Rust Risk | Does not carry the classic steel rust problem | Advantageous against corrosion due to aluminum structure |
| Usage Area | Dry cargo, service use, commercial shipments and light logistics | Logistics, service, distribution and light to medium commercial loads |
Difference Between Polyester Body and Tarpaulin Body
A tarpaulin body can be a more economical and practical transport solution with its flexible openable structure. A polyester body creates a more fixed, enclosed, clean and corporate cargo area. If goods need to be transported inside a closed, clean and more organized body, a polyester body may be more suitable. If loading flexibility, economical cost and an openable structure are more important, a tarpaulin body can be preferred.
| Comparison Criteria | Polyester Body | Tarpaulin Body |
|---|---|---|
| Cargo Protection | Provides a fixed and enclosed cargo area | Protection depends on tarpaulin quality and closing system |
| Exterior Appearance | Offers a cleaner, smoother and more corporate appearance | Provides a more flexible and economical appearance |
| Loading Method | Depends on door and panel layout | Can provide flexible access when the tarpaulin is opened |
| Usage Area | Dry cargo, service, commercial goods and light distribution | General cargo, palletized goods and economical transport jobs |
| Maintenance Need | Surface and connection points should be monitored | Tarpaulin, tensioning parts and connection equipment should be checked |
| Preferred Reason | For businesses that need a clean, fixed and enclosed cargo area | For businesses that need economical and flexible loading |

How Are Polyester Body Dimensions Determined?
Polyester body dimensions should be determined according to the vehicle chassis structure, load capacity, wheelbase, legal dimension limits, cargo volume, daily loading frequency and usage route. Making a larger body is not always the correct approach. A body larger than necessary can negatively affect road balance, increase fuel consumption, raise wind resistance and reduce maneuverability.
Correct dimension planning should include body length, body width, interior height, door opening, useful payload capacity, floor type and additional equipment needs. If boxes, parcels and light commercial products will be transported, efficient use of interior volume is important. If service equipment, devices, spare parts or technical materials will be transported, shelves, partitions and cargo securing details should be considered. For this reason, a polyester body should be dimensioned according to the real working model of the vehicle.
How Should the Floor of a Polyester Body Be?
One of the most important sections of a polyester body is the floor. Even if the body has a lightweight structure, the main cargo weight presses on the floor. Boxes, equipment, service materials, commercial products, textile goods or light industrial loads constantly apply pressure to the body floor. If the floor is weak, flexing, sagging, noise, surface deformation and cargo safety problems may occur over time.
Depending on the purpose of use, plywood, marine plywood, metal supported floor, anti slip surface coating or specially reinforced floor solutions can be used in polyester bodies. A standard durable floor may be sufficient for light urban distribution, while reinforced floors should be preferred for service vehicles or heavier loads. A good floor should be strong, easy to clean, slip reducing and suitable for daily commercial use.

How Should a Polyester Body Be Maintained?
A polyester body requires regular inspection for long lasting use. Although the polyester surface does not carry the classic rust problem of steel, impact, friction, incorrect loading, loose connections and surface cracks may create problems over time. For this reason, doors, hinges, locks, floor, seals, panel surfaces and connection points should be inspected periodically.
- Exterior and interior surfaces should be checked for cracks, breaks, impact marks and surface deformation.
- Rear doors and side doors should be inspected for closing quality, gaps and alignment.
- Hinge and lock systems should be maintained according to usage intensity.
- The body floor should be checked for wear, cracks, sagging and slippery areas.
- Door seals should be inspected against water and dust leakage risk.
- Interior surfaces should be cleaned after dirty or dusty loads.
- If there is advertising wrap on the exterior surface, bubbling, peeling and surface damage should be monitored.
- After impact or accident, the frame, connection points and panel surfaces should be checked.
Polyester Body or Sheet Metal Body: Which Is More Practical?
The answer depends on the cargo type and usage expectations of the business. If lightness, clean surface, modern appearance and enclosed cargo area are priorities, a polyester body can be a practical choice. If heavier, rougher, impact based and intensive industrial loads will be transported, a sheet metal body may be more suitable. There is no single correct answer; the correct body should be determined according to the real working conditions of the vehicle.
The decision should not be based only on the first price. Body weight, sensitivity of transported goods, daily usage intensity, maintenance cost, exterior appearance expectation, service life and after sales support should be evaluated together. In some projects, a polyester body provides long term benefits with its lightness and clean surface. In other projects, a sheet metal body may be the better choice with its impact resistance and economical strength balance.
